  • Title

    A spread spectrum PRMA protocol for microcellular networks

  • Abstract
    A spread spectrum PRMA (SSPRMA) is proposed. We analyze its throughput, and the probability of voice packet being dropped (Pdrop) by Markov chain analysis. Numerical results prove that SSPRMA enjoys a higher statistical multiplexing gain, however, SSPRMA also suffers drastic deterioration under heavy load condition
